2015. 5. 23. 15:07ㆍ안드로이드 Apps
http://www.matcl.com/?m=bbs&uid=256977&XposedforSamsungLollipopbyarter97
/* 소개 */
세달이나 지나서 겨우 나온 삼성 롤리팝 펌웨어용 Xposed 프레임워크입니다.
/* 왜 이제서야? */
AOSP와 비해 삼성이 ART 런타임에 바꾼게 너무 많고 시스템 파티션 용량도 부족해서 xz 압축 기법을 도입하는 방법을 사용해서
여태껏 AOSP향인 Xposed ART 런타임이 작동되지 않았습니다.
/* 알림 */
개발자는 단단해진 기기, 메모리 사망이나 알람 어플리케이션이 실패하여 직장에서
해고당하는 등에 대하여 일체 책임이 없습니다.
이 자료를 선택하여 설치하는 것은 '당신'입니다.
기기가 꼬인 것을 제 책임으로 돌린다면 전 당신을 비웃을 겁니다. 엄청요.
/* 지원 펌웨어 */
디오덱스된 롬만 지원합니다.
32비트 삼성 롤리팝 안드로이드 5.0 디오덱스 펌웨어면 모두 지원될겁니다.
테스트는 S4, Note 3, S5에서만 진행되었다는 점도 알아주세요.
64비트나 안드로이드 5.1은 지원하지 않습니다.
/* 다운로드 */
/* 설치 법 */
1. 백업. 제발 백업하세요.
2. http://forum.xda-developers.com/showthread.php?t=3034811 에서 XposedInstaller 앱 설치
3. XDA 쓰레드에 첨부된 Xposed framework zip파일을 리커버리에서 설치
/* 기술 정보 */
http://forum.xda-developers.com/showpost.php?p=60857327&postcount=2
/* Q&A */
Q: 계속 http://pastebin.com/MxeAE76n 이와 같은 로그가 반복됩니다.
A: 시스템 안정성에 크게 영향을 줄 수 있으므로 반드시 픽스법을 따라주세요. (테스트 상 국내 Galaxy S5 모델들은 픽스법이 필요할 겁니다)
다운로드받은 Xposed framework zip파일을 리커버리에서 설치할 때 무슨 core-libart.jar 파일이 설치되는지 표시됩니다.
core-libart1.jar가 설치되었으면 zip파일에서 system/framework/core-libart2.jar 파일을 /system/framework/core-libart.jar로 교체해주시고,
반대로
core-libart2.jar가 설치되었으면 zip파일에서 system/framework/core-libart1.jar 파일을 /system/framework/core-libart.jar로 교체해주세요.
Q: 디오덱스 어떻게 하나요/설치하나요?
A: artware를 사용하거나 http://forum.xda-developers.com/android/software-hacking/script-app-joeldroid-lollipop-batch-t2980857 / http://forum.xda-developers.com/galaxy-s5/general/tool-deodex-tool-android-l-t2972025 를 이용해서 직접 디오덱스하세요.
Q: 소스 내놔!
A: https://github.com/arter97/android_art/tree/samsung-lollipop
Q: "ㄱㄴㄷ" 모듈이 지원되지 않아요!
A: 개발자가 아직 터치위즈용으로 업데이트하지 않아서 그런거 같습니다.
Q: 야이 마더빠더젠틀맨아, 너때메 폰이 매우 단단해졌잖아...
A: 제가 테스트할 수 있는 기기는 3개밖에 없어서 나머지 기종에 대해선 알 수 없습니다. 엑시노스는 지원하는지도 모르고요.
백업하라고 전 분명히 말씀드렸습니다. 지원 추가해보고싶으시면 로그 첨부 부탁드립니다.
/* 스크린샷 */
http://forum.xda-developers.com/showpost.php?p=60857330&postcount=3